Features

  • 7 Inputs4 musical instrument inputs and 3 auxiliary inputs, which can fully satisfy a small band. It can connect 2 instruments (guitar, piano, keyboard, etc.), 2 microphones, two mobile phones or computers at the same time. Two independent EQ effects adjustment , Boost or attenuate the low-frequency, mid-frequency and high-frequency DB values.
  • 120 WattDouble 8- inch woofer and Double 2-inch tweeter deliver clear, lifelike ,dynamic, powerful sound; A 120 watt continue power amplifier pumps up the volume.
  • BluetoothProvide with options of wireless connection, phone input, CD/MP3 input, and USB plugin, it is able to fit in the different connection types, it is convenient and useful with its master control, headphone input and DI output.
  • RechargeableIt can run up to 6-8 hours depends on the volume you use after 5 hours charge. And it can work with a connection directly to the electricity.
  • Condenser microphone switch: The microphone1 interface is designed with 48V phantom power, compatible with condenser microphones and dynamic microphones.

  • BP60D Great Amp But...
I perform regularly. 1-2 booked gigs a week and busking here and there inbetween. My main amp is a Fender Acoustic SFX II. I bought the BP60D as a monitor / travel amp / back up amp. My overall experience with the BP60D is positive. Its sound is comparable to my Fender. While my Fender sounds warmer, rounder and fuller, the BP60D is more neutral, FRFR. Battery power is very convenient and lasts the amount of time that is advertised. I really like that it has a lot of inputs, that it can be positioned two ways, an amp mute button, and that it has nice volume output. However, I wouldn't count on the chorus effect being sublime. Its reverb does the job if you're just looking for some basic Room reverb. Anything Hall and above you should be using a pedal. EDIT 12.21.2023 - My first BP60D had some issues. After reaching out a couple times to CoolMusic customer service I was able to make contact and was sent a replacement by the Seller. Very cool, thank you! BUT... I've tried communicating that there are several functions that don't work as described in the instruction manual (causing me major stress during several gigs), but all I was told in the end is that this amp isn't for me. Dunno why a Seller would say that to a customer who is just trying to give honest feedback and ask for clarification on functionality, but all good. Outside of music, my background is product design, so maybe I care more than the average person that functions should be correctly stated in an instruction manual. So here's my findings for future buyers to save you some stress: 1. Plugging into AMP IN, SEND/RETURN makes the BP60D a PASSIVE PA. Volume is NOT controlled independently. This is NOT stated in the instruction manual. Otherwise Main Volume control works as intended. 2. If you want to use this as a monitor or active PA, I suggest plugging into GUITAR/MIC inputs. 3. LINE IN produced NO SOUND when going line out from my Fender with an XLR to 1/4" stereo TRS into LINE IN on the BP60D. But it does work with a mono TS. This is NOT stated in the instruction manual. 4. 3.5mm Aux Port is labeled RECORD OUT and the instruction manual can be interpreted to mean that this port outputs sound for recording to another device. IT DOES NOT. It is INPUT ONLY, not bi-directional. The instructions are not clear on this. 5. EDIT 12.23.2023 - I did experience a clicking / knocking sound playing a shaker through my internal MiSi mic right outside my uke's soundhole. This happened at the beginning of the set. This could have been my mic being overdriven or the amp taking time to warm up. I did not experience this when I lowered my mic volume on my pickup for the rest of my 2 hours playing. 6. No comment on the MP3 USB port as I have not used it yet. ... show more
